Our Earlsfield Team is With You Through Every Step
Our team, led by owner Tony O'Flaherty, brings together experienced Care Professionals who understand the unique needs of each client. As a Dementia Ambassador who actively supports the Alzheimer's Society, Tony, alongside Care Managers Sophie and Lorna, ensures every member of our Care Team receives specialist training in dementia and complex care needs, drawing on his own experience of the transformative power of exceptional care during his recovery from a serious injury.
We bring that same expertise into Earlsfield and the surrounding areas, running free dementia cafés at King's College Hospital SE5, Balham Baptist Church SW12, and All Saints Church SE21. Our team delivers free Alzheimer's Dementia Friends awareness sessions to help create more understanding communities, while our weekly chair exercise classes provide gentle physical activity for both clients and local residents. We also bring people together through our Memory Cafés and Singing for Wellbeing groups, offering vital support to those living with dementia and their families.
